The 1921 Emperor's Cup was the first edition of the Emperor's Cup competition.
It was contested by four teams, and Tokyo Shukyu-dan won the cup. The winning team consisted of graduates from Toshima Teachers College, Aoyama Teachers College and Tokyo Teachers College. [1]
